I just bought a Kenwood DNX8120 Nav. system. Also have the Nav faceplate from LSK.

How much should the install be with a backup camera and have my steering wheel wired to program the volume and station change?

Custom Sounds here is Austin is wanting about $200 for a Kenwood backup camera. $150 to wire to my steering wheel. $400 for custom installation... Tax and other crap.... About $900+ for custom install.

I have already purchased the Nav. system....

Am I getting ripped off???

i would suggest you do the nav install yourself. the back up camera and the steering wheel hook up you should leave it to them. i paid 40 bucks to get my camera installed and the installer was charging me 50 to do the steering wheel hook up. i'd say shop around. i think the most anyone should pay for an install (deck alone) should be in the 150-200 range at most



Posted by: 1LoudLS

D@mn, im working in the wrong town, my shop only charges $100 for the head unit $40 for the steering wheel adapter and $40 for the back up camera and maybe a half hour of custom labor to modify the fact nav trim, and we are high priced only because Ann Arbor is loaded with high priced luxury cars
